About the Project
Information Security Education and Awareness (ISEA) is an initiative of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ology (MeitY), Government of India for generating human resources in the area of Information Security and creating general awareness on Cyber Hygiene/Cyber Security among the masses.

Structure
The hackathon will be conducted over a period of 5 months with three rounds of evaluation.
- Phase 1: Registration – Call for participation through portal.
- Phase 2: Evaluation 1 – Presentation for Shortlisting top 40-50 teams based on innovation and feasibility of solutions. (Online)
- Phase 3: Prototype Development Evaluation 2 – Teams develop prototypes with mentorship support. Mid-term evaluation shortlists top 20-30 teams. (Online) (Presentations and DEMO)
- Phase 4: Final Evaluation & Presentation – Finalists present working solutions before a panel of judges, which undergoes continuous evaluation. Winners are selected. (IIT Jammu) (20-30 Teams)
